Treatment of Severe and Persistent Vertigo Associated with Underlying Illness
For severe and persistent vertigo associated with underlying illness, treatment depends critically on the specific diagnosis: canalith repositioning procedures (Epley maneuver) are first-line for BPPV, vestibular rehabilitation therapy is primary for persistent vestibular dysfunction, and vestibular suppressant medications like meclizine (25-100 mg daily) provide only symptomatic relief and should not be used routinely for BPPV. 1, 2, 3
Initial Diagnostic Classification
Before treating persistent vertigo, you must first classify the timing pattern to guide management:
- Acute persistent vertigo (days to weeks of constant symptoms) suggests vestibular neuritis, labyrinthitis, or central causes like stroke 2, 4
- Brief episodic vertigo (seconds to minutes triggered by head movements) indicates BPPV 2
- Chronic vestibular syndrome (weeks to months) points to medication side effects, anxiety disorders, or posttraumatic vertigo 2
Treatment Based on Specific Diagnosis
For BPPV (Most Common Cause)
Canalith repositioning procedures are the definitive treatment:
- Perform the Epley maneuver for posterior canal BPPV with 80% success after 1-3 treatments and 90-98% success with repeat maneuvers 1, 2
- Do not recommend postprocedural postural restrictions after the procedure 1
- Do not routinely use vestibular suppressant medications for BPPV 1
- Reassess within 1 month to document resolution or persistence 1
Critical pitfall: If symptoms persist after initial repositioning, repeat the Dix-Hallpike test—treatment failures may have persistent BPPV requiring additional maneuvers, canal conversion (posterior to lateral canal or vice versa in up to 6% of cases), or coexisting vestibular dysfunction 1
For Vestibular Neuritis/Labyrinthitis
Acute phase management:
- Labyrinthitis presents with sudden severe vertigo lasting >24 hours with profound hearing loss, distinguishing it from vestibular neuritis (no hearing loss) 4
- Initial stabilization may include short-term vestibular suppressants (meclizine 25-100 mg daily in divided doses) for symptom control during the acute phase 3, 5
- Transition quickly to vestibular rehabilitation exercises rather than prolonged medication use 5
Vestibular rehabilitation is the primary intervention:
- Significantly improves gait stability compared to medication alone 2
- Particularly beneficial for elderly patients, those with CNS disorders, or heightened fall risk 2
- Includes habituation exercises, gaze stabilization, balance retraining, and fall prevention 2
For Persistent Symptoms After Initial Treatment
Systematic reevaluation is mandatory:
- Repeat the Dix-Hallpike maneuver to confirm persistent BPPV versus other causes 1
- Consider coexisting vestibular conditions—treatment failure is most common in BPPV secondary to head trauma or vestibular neuritis due to widespread vestibular system dysfunction 1
- Evaluate for CNS disorders masquerading as BPPV (found in 3% of treatment failures) 1
- Assess for Menière's disease or migraine, which increase recurrence risk and fall risk 1
Medication Use: Limited Role
Vestibular suppressants have a narrow indication:
- Meclizine is FDA-approved for vertigo associated with vestibular system diseases at 25-100 mg daily in divided doses 3
- Use only for acute symptom reduction, not as definitive treatment 3, 5
- Common adverse reactions include drowsiness, dry mouth, headache, and fatigue 3
- Prescribe with caution in patients with asthma, glaucoma, or prostate enlargement due to anticholinergic effects 3
- Avoid coadministration with other CNS depressants including alcohol 3
Critical guideline: Do not routinely treat BPPV with vestibular suppressant medications such as antihistamines or benzodiazepines 1
Red Flags Requiring Urgent Evaluation
Immediate imaging and neurologic consultation are needed for:
- Focal neurological deficits, sudden hearing loss, or inability to stand/walk 2
- New severe headache accompanying vertigo 2
- Downbeating nystagmus or other central nystagmus patterns 2
- Speech difficulties, dysphagia, visual disturbances, or motor/sensory deficits 4
- Failure to respond to appropriate vestibular treatments 2
Imaging considerations:
- MRI brain without contrast (not CT) is preferred when central causes are suspected—CT has only 20-40% sensitivity for posterior circulation infarcts 2
- No imaging is indicated for typical BPPV with positive Dix-Hallpike test and no additional concerning features 2
Common Pitfalls to Avoid
- Do not assume a normal neurologic exam excludes stroke—75-80% of patients with acute vestibular syndrome from posterior circulation infarct have no focal neurologic deficits 2
- Do not rely on patient descriptions of "spinning" versus "lightheadedness"—focus on timing and triggers instead 2
- Do not use prolonged vestibular suppressants when vestibular rehabilitation is indicated 2, 5
- Do not order routine imaging or vestibular testing for straightforward BPPV 2
Follow-Up and Patient Education
- Reassess all patients within 1 month after initial treatment to document resolution or persistence 1
- Educate patients about BPPV recurrence risk, fall risk, and the importance of returning promptly for repeat repositioning procedures 2
- For treatment failures refractory to multiple repositioning procedures, surgical options (posterior semicircular canal plugging or singular neurectomy) have >96% success rates, though data quality limits definitive recommendations 1
